| Primary schools in Xiamen started to enroll students on August 13-14. A record number of children were born in 2000 (see photo above), so the primary school admission numbers were much higher than normal. It made for a stressful two days for both schools and parents. In Siming district alone, the number of primary school students increased by 1,200 on last year. The mini baby boom was attributed to the 2000 Year of the Dragon, which was considered a lucky year in China. Photos by Yao Fan |
